(PHP 4 >= 4.1.0, PHP 5, PHP 7, PHP 8)
socket_listen — Hört einen Socket nach Verbindungsanforderungen ab
   Nachdem der Socket socket mit socket_create()
   erzeugt und mit socket_bind() mit einem Namen verknüpft
   wurde, wird er angewiesen, nach hereinkommenden Verbindungsanforderungen
   an dem Socket socket zu horchen.
  
   socket_listen() kann nur zusammen mit Sockets vom Typ
   SOCK_STREAM oder SOCK_SEQPACKET
   verwendet werden.
  
socketEine Socket-Instanz, die mit socket_create() oder socket_addrinfo_bind() erzeugt wurde.
backlog
       Maximal werden backlog hereinkommende
       Verbindungsanforderungen zur späteren Verarbeitung in die
       Warteschlange gestellt. Falls eine Verbindungsanforderung ankommt,
       wenn die Warteschlange voll ist, bekommt der Client eine
       Fehlermeldung mit dem Hinweis ECONNREFUSED.
       Oder, falls das zugrundeliegende Protokoll eine wiederholte
       Übertragung unterstützt, wird die Anforderung ignoriert, so dass
       weitere Verbindungsversuche möglicherweise erfolgreich sind.
      
Hinweis:
Die maximale Anzahl der im Parameter
backlogangegebenen Einträge der Warteschlange hängt entscheidend vom darunterliegenden Betriebssystem ab. Auf Linux-Systemen wird die Zahl stillschweigend aufSOMAXCONNbegrenzt. Wenn auf Win32-SystemenSOMAXCONNgesetzt ist, ist der Dienstanbieter verantwortlich für den Socket und muss die Warteschlange auf einen vernünftigen Maximalwert begrenzen. Es gibt für diese Systeme keine standardmäßige Möglichkeit, den aktuellen Wert herauszufinden.
   Gibt bei Erfolg true zurück. Bei einem Fehler wird false zurückgegeben. Der Fehlercode kann mit der Funktion
   socket_last_error() abgefragt werden. Dieser
   Fehlercode kann an die Funktion socket_strerror()
   übergeben werden, um eine textuelle Beschreibung des Fehlers zu erhalten.
  
| Version | Beschreibung | 
|---|---|
| 8.0.0 | socketist nun eine
   Socket-Instanz; vorher war es eine
   resource. | 
